Gastrodia elata harvest timeGastrodia elata is planted in different seasons and the harvest time is different. If it is planted in winter, it will generally be harvested in the winter of the second year or the spring of the third year. If it is planted in spring, it will generally be harvested in the winter of the current year or the spring of the second year. The spring harvest is called spring gastrodia elata. Gastrodia elata originThe area of Gastrodia elata cultivation in my country is relatively large. The main production areas are Shennongjia in the Three Gorges of the Yangtze River, Changbai Mountain, Yunnan-Guizhou Plateau, Dabie Mountains, etc. Among them, Shennongjia in the Three Gorges of the Yangtze River is the area with the largest output in my country, while the Yunnan-Guizhou Plateau mainly grows black-red hybrid Gastrodia elata and red Gastrodia elata, which are the varieties with the best quality. Gastrodia elata planting time and key points1. Planting time Under normal circumstances, it is more suitable to plant Gastrodia elata from November of each year to March of the following year. The climate environment during this period is more suitable for growth. It is best to choose a time when the weather is relatively clear when planting. 2. Planting points When planting Gastrodia elata, you need to use tree species with solid wood that is easy to inoculate as the fungus material. Generally, you can choose broad-leaved trees, such as oak, cork oak, water melon, birch, etc. When selecting a cultivation site for Gastrodia elata, you need to choose sandy loam that is breathable and well-drained, and the slope should be less than 45 degrees. It is best to plant it in a place sheltered from the wind and facing the sun, which is extremely beneficial for its growth. |
